Ticket: Staging env misconfigured for Siftgate bloom filter

The bloom layer in front of the Pellet KV store is rejecting all lookups in staging because the env file was copied from the dev template without credentials. False-positive tuning values are fine; only the auth line is missing. To unblock the weekly demo, the Pellet admission secret must be set on the following line.

env line for yaguf-fajop: LEDGER_TOKEN13=fb08984397349

## Changelog — Reportsmith 4.2: Default Sort Stability

Sort in the Reportsmith builder is now stable by default. Previously, ties in grouped columns could reorder between runs, causing diff noise in scheduled exports. Stable sort adds roughly 4% to render time on large reports; opt out per report if needed. Existing saved reports are unaffected until re-saved. New defaults take effect with the following configuration.

deployment values, yadug-bawif:
[framir]
team = pelox
access_code = ac_a38ab2
owner = tamion.julael
host = framir.tolvaqlabs.test
port = 11211
peer = tammir.zemvargrid.local
salt = 2215ef03
pin = 1541

Subject: Tide-table widget staging access

Hi Brinewell integration team,

The ShoreCast tide-table widget is now live on our staging environment for Port Amberlyn data. Support should use the staging endpoint when reproducing customer-reported rendering issues, since production rate limits will block repeated calls. Refresh intervals default to 15 minutes; don't change this during testing. All requests must be authenticated. For staging verification, use the bearer token below.

bearer token for yahop-fahof: eyJhbGciOiJIUzI1NiIsInR5cCI6IkpXVCJ9.eyJzdWIiOiI9RJZOrIn0.zwQQt5bI

Ticket: Config drift in Pellwick report exports

Staging and production disagree on timezone handling again. Staging renders export timestamps in the tenant's local zone; production falls back to UTC with no offset annotation. This resurfaced after last week's redeploy of the export worker. Please confirm the intended behavior before merging the fix. Current production values are shown below.

config for kafof-bawef:
holath:
  log_level: debug
  metrics_host: metrics.holath.qorvelsys.internal
  pin: 2191
  pool_size: 32